In exchange for services rendered during the October Revolution - its crew fired the blank cannon shot that triggered the storming of the Winter Palace - and during the siege of Leningrad in 1941, the Aurora cruiser, a Russian warship built in 1900, was transformed into a museum. Restored and moored on the Great Neva, visitors can view the vessel's command systems and gain an insight into the history of its commanders and the crew's daily life. Somewhat obscure for non-Russian speakers.
